  • Hi there, I have an adopted 4yr old, Sir I, with Fragile X Syndrome, so I was not the carrier. There is an AWESOME Fragile X facebook page that is super active and supportive. I not sure how to post the link here, but search for Fragile X in facebook and you should find it.

    There are loads of women there from all walks of life: those who knew nothing about Fragile X prior to having kids; those who knew they were carriers & chose to have kids; those who had daignosed kids & had more; those who adopted with no idea what was coming; those who adopted knowing about the Fragile X; and every other type you can imagine :)

    I can't help you too much with your worrying before being tested & then deciding what to do. As you m ight know, if you are a FX carrier, there is a 50% chance you'll pass that X chromosone onto any kids you have. I did do the waiting for blood work to come back on Sir I and hat waiting was tough. He was diagnosed 2 yrs ago and is doing as well as possible. He is still non-verbal, wears diapers and needs constant supervision and, to be honest, there are some really rough days with him. Being non-verbal he whines ALOT, and I think since he started having seizures that aren't 100% controlled yet,  he has lost some of his sign-langauge.

    However, he brings so much laughter to our family. He loves being the center of attention and tries to copy everything his older (biological) brother does. Even on the hard days, I couldn't see our family without him.

  • My DS1 was diagnosed with an x-linked intellectual disability, similar to fragile x, at 15 months, when I was 4 weeks pregnant.  I found out 8 weeks later that I am the carrier, however I am a de novo so my parents don't carry the gene.  Was your mom tested and found to be a carrier?  If not, your brother could have been a de novo mutation and then your chance is the same as anyone else's as being a carrier.
